Keeping neighborhoods safe

Living in the area of the Armory at East Rodney Drive and Independence Street is a pleasurable experience. I love the diversity of the neighborhood and especially enjoy the children playing in our common area.

The unfortunate part of living in an area with a lot of apartment complexes is the high rate of turnover.

As a rule, about 98 percent of the people are good, hard-working people just trying to live and enjoy life. But with this turnover, every once in a while you get an unsurly group that comes in. Most people that move into this area do it to get their children into an area away from an area where there is a lot of the bad element.

Good people of the area, when you see activity in the area that reminds you of activity that you moved to this area to get away from, there is a number you can call. That is 573-335-6621. This is the number of the Cape Girardeau Police Department. Believe it or not, they are friendly and are interested in hearing about these questionable activities.

If you would like to keep your neighborhood safe for your children, you must keep your protectors informed of this activity.

Let's keep our neighborhood safe, if not nothing else for these innocent children. They deserve it, and it's the least we can do.

MICHAEL L. JOYNER, Cape Girardeau
